Специалисты
Навыки:
Java-JavaEE-Spring (Boot/Web/Data/MVC,Cloud)-REST-SOAP-RabbitMQ-ActiveMQ-Firebird-MS SQL Server-PostgreSQL-JPA/Hibernate-JAXB-JDBC-Tomcat-Maven-Gradle-WildFly-Glassfish-Docker-Oracle Core Java-JavaEE
-MongoD-HTML5-jQueryUI-KendoUI-Kotlin -Liqubase -Bootstrap-Vaadin-XML-Angular4-Vue.js-Mockito- KISS-DRY-Nginx-Kafka
2012 – Российский государственный гуманитарный университет, Киров
Прикладная информатика
Сервис для обработки данных клиентов для банка SOAP микросервисная архитектура
Программист Java Чем занимался на проекте / обязанности / задачи: • Разработкой SOAP сервиса для Альфа-банка • Микросервисная архитектура (4 сервиса + внешние, от самого банка) • NoSQL база Tarantool (собственная разработка VK) • Kafka для обмена данными и Elastic Search для поиска. • Архитектурные решения, выбор библиотеки для XML маппинга или виртуальные треды Состав команды: тимлид, devops, аналитик, java разработчик
Java 21, Kafka, Spring-WS, Tarantool, Docker, Elastic Search, Prometheus.
Август 2023 — настоящее время месяцев
ИТ-компания, создающая веб-сервисы разного уровня сложности: от посадочных страниц до интернет-магазинов и высоконагруженных проектов и сервисов
Чем занимался на проекте / обязанности / задачи: • Поддержка автоматизированной системы учета для Главного Радиочастотного Центра • Доработка (исправление багов, перенос на Linux) старой версии системы (толстый desktop клиент на JavaFX + back-end на Spring+JPA/EclipseLink). • Рефакторинг back-end части для новой версии системы с разбиением монолита на микросервисы (Spring Boot, брокер RabbitMQ, Docker). • Написание скриптов миграций для Luiqibase, использовалась база данных PostgreSQL. Состав команды: Команда в проекте 30 человек, 10 разработчиков (back-end, front-end), тестировщики, аналитики и специалисты по БД. Отдельный департамент из сисадминов и DevOps"ов
Java 17, Java FX, Spring Boot, Eclipse Link, Liquibase, RabbitMQ, Docker, Nginx
Июнь 2022 — Июль 2023 месяца
Управляющая, инвестиционная компания (управление активами). Услуги в области осуществления инвестиций в акции, облигации, паевые фонды (ПИФы), валюту
Чем занимался на проекте / обязанности / задачи: • Разработка и поддержка внутреннего проекта компании - автоматического генератора отчетов в формате XBRL. • Доработка генератора при выпуске новых версий формата от Центробанка РФ (генерация XML правильного формата + тесты). • Выполнение задач по front-end-разработке. Состав команды: 2 back-end разработчика, 1 front-end разработчик, 1 тестировщик, 2 разработчика 1C и 1 архитектор БД (Oracle), руководитель отдела
Java 8, Spring, Apache POI, Oracle, JAXB, Vue.js, Quasar. В качестве сервера приложений использовался GlassFish
Январь 2021 — Май 2022 месяца
компания, специализирующаяся на разработке и тестировании программного обеспечения для организаций, являющихся мировыми лидерами финансовой индустрии
Чем занимался на проекте / обязанности / задачи: • Заказная проектная разработка. • Написание на Kotlin набора интеграционных тестов для сайта Лондонской фондовой биржи (финансовый протокол FIX). • Проверка корректности отправляемых по UDP сообщений (торги, аукционы и другие события). Состав команды: команда из 5 человек
Kotlin, Netty, vert.x.
Сентябрь 2019 — Февраль 2020 месяцев
Компания-лидер в области автоматизации управления логистикой, создатель самых популярных в России автоматизированных систем управления складом (в том числе AXELOT WMS X5) и решения для транспортной логистики AXELOT TMS X4.
Чем занимался на проекте / обязанности / задачи: • Участие в разработке продукта компании Axelot Datareon ESB (энтерпрайзная шина уровня предприятия). • Перевод проекта с ASP.NET MVC на .NET Core. • Создание инсталлятора на WiX. • Перевод GUI с Java SWT на Angular2, в формат Web-приложения. Состав команды: несколько распределенных команд
.NET Core, GraphQL, WiX Installer, Angular2, RxJS, SignalR, Web Sockets, Java SWT.
Июнь 2018 — Август 2019 месяцев
Компания-разработчик информационных систем и сервисов в сфере государственного управления, инфраструктурной интеграции, информационной безопасности.
Чем занимался на проекте / обязанности / задачи: • Разработка Web-сервисов (SOAP) для системы "Находка-Загс" для выгрузки данных из базы на государственные сайты (портал ЕЗагс, Росказна и др.) на базе СМЭВ. • Разработка библиотеки на Delphi для ЭЦП с использованием "КриптоПро" Состав команды: команда из 10 разработчиков
Glassfish, Web Services (JAX-WS), Hibernate/JPA, JSF, Delphi, MS SQL Server, КриптоПро CSP.
Январь 2014 — Декабрь 2015 месяцев
Системный интегратор, автоматизатор технологических и бизнес-процессов предприятия, ИТ-консалтинг
Чем занимался на проекте / обязанности / задачи: • Разработка портлетов (модулей) для BPMS системы Elewise ELMA: загрузчик файлов по FTP, рассылка сообщений в Jabber, ICQ, Twitter, Facebook и Вконтакте (код ASP.NET MVC и пользовательский интерфейс на KendoUI (HTML5/CSS3/jQuery). • Доработка приложения на Qt, взаимодействующего с базой данных Firebird. Состав команды: команда из 10 разработчиков
ASP.NET MVC, ADO.NET Entity Framework/LINQ, jQuery, KendoUI, C++/Qt, Firebird.
Август 2012 — Декабрь 2013 месяцев